See the full analysis — freeAdmission rate
Whitman College admitted 38.1% of applicants university-wide (2,763 of 7,243).
| Cohort | Admit rate | Admitted | Applicants |
|---|---|---|---|
| University-wide | 38.1% | 2,763 | 7,243 |
| In-state | 64.4% | 839 | 1,302 |
| Out-of-state | 63.5% | 1,677 | 2,642 |
| International applicants | 7.6% | 247 | 3,259 |
| Early Decision (binding) | 19.0% | 114 | 599 |
| Men | 31.1% | 1,017 | 3,271 |
| Women | 43.8% | 1,735 | 3,957 |
Early Decision applicants were admitted at 19%, vs 38.1% overall — ED is a binding commitment.
Also offers Early Action — the Common Data Set doesn't publish EA admit counts.
Of 2,763 admitted students, 390 enrolled (14.1% yield).
Whitman College U.S. Dept. of Education College Scorecard · Sections C1–C2 · 2023 — Published cohort admit rates — context, not an applicant-specific probability.
Test scores and GPA of admitted students
- SAT (mid-50%)
- 1330–1470
- ACT (mid-50%)
- 29–33
- GPA (mid-50%, 4.0 scale)
- 3.50–3.99
Testing policy: Test-optional (considered if submitted)
Whitman College U.S. Dept. of Education College Scorecard · Sections C9–C12 · 2023 — Published admit stats reflect the entire incoming class unless explicitly labeled international-only.
Cost and financial aid
Published cost of attendance: $85,230/yr.
| Out-of-state tuition | $64,050 |
| Fees, housing, food, books & other | $21,180 |
| Sticker cost of attendance | $85,230/yr |
Average net price by family income (US, federal aid data)
| Under $30k | $13,567 |
| $30k–48k | $11,596 |
| $48k–75k | $21,915 |
| $75k–110k | $27,237 |
| Over $110k | $47,679 |

Graduate outcomes
- Median earnings
- $67,589
- Median earnings · 10 years after entry
- Graduation rate
- 80.5%
- Within 150% of normal time
- First-year retention
- 88.7%
- Return for year two · CDS Section B
- Median debt
- $18,437
- At graduation
Whitman College · U.S. Dept. of Education College Scorecard (2023 release) · 2023 — Earnings and debt figures are federal data for aid-receiving graduates — cohort outcomes, not a guarantee for any individual student.

Academics and campus
Largest degree fields: Social sciences (25%), Biological & life sciences (17%), Psychology (12%).
Student–faculty ratio: 10:1 · 69% of class sections have under 20 students.
